Located a few feet from the schoolhouse where the idea for the Order of Knights of Pythias came to the young teacher who became its founder, Justus Rathbone.

Granite marker with bas-relief of Justus Rathbone on the front. Bronze plaque on the back reads:

PYTHIAN SHRINE

While teaching school here in
1860 and 1861, Justus Henry Rathbone,
founder of the order, Knights of
Pythias, wrote the first ritual of
the order.
This property was purchased by
members living in Michigan in 1905.
It was presented to the Grand
Domain of Michigan in 1921, who in turn
presented it to the Supreme Lodge
Knights of Pythias, August 16, 1930.
It is the purpose of the members
of the order to perpetuate it as
a Pythian Shrine and to express
reverence to the beloved founder.
-------
Officially dedicated this 11th day
of July, A.D. 1931
